        AN ACT to amend the education law, in relation to the universal full-day
          pre-kindergarten program; and  to  repeal  subdivision  4  of  section
          3602-ee of such law relating thereto
 
          The  People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
 
     1    Section 1. Subdivision 4 of section 3602-ee of the  education  law  is
     2  REPEALED.
     3    §  2. Subdivisions 1 and 5 of section 3602-ee of the education law, as
     4  added by section 1 of part CC of chapter 56 of the  laws  of  2014,  are
     5  amended to read as follows:
     6    1.  The  purpose of the universal full-day pre-kindergarten program is
     7  to incentivize and  fund  state-of-the-art  innovative  pre-kindergarten
     8  programs [and to encourage program creativity through competition].
     9    5.  The  department shall develop a scoring system, which it shall use
    10  to evaluate which applications shall be funded [on a competitive  basis]
    11  based  on  merit  and  factors including but not limited to the criteria
    12  listed above and student and community need. [Upon  review  of  applica-
    13  tions,  if the program is oversubscribed in any region or regions of the
    14  state, the department shall notify the division  of  the  budget,  which
    15  shall  develop  a  plan  for  distribution of available slots within any
    16  oversubscribed region.] The subscription for the New York city region is
    17  three hundred million dollars. The subscription for each region  of  the
    18  state  other  than the New York city region shall be in an amount suffi-
    19  cient to provide slots for all qualifying programs. The department shall

     1  allocate full-day pre-kindergarten conversion  slots  and  new  full-day
     2  pre-kindergarten  slots  based  on  available  funding  and  shall  make
     3  payments upon documentation of eligible expenditures in the  base  year,
     4  which  shall  be limited to the actual number of slots operated and paid
     5  on a per-pupil basis pursuant to subdivision fourteen of this section.
     6    § 3. This act shall take effect on the first of July  next  succeeding
     7  the date on which it shall have become a law.
